This year was the first time I have been to the Cowra Show.
I was disappointed on three counts.
First, the difference in entry fee from day to day, especially the age pension only discount.
Surely a person on a disability or carers pension should also be entitled to the same discount.
Secondly, the food available to me at the time was very unsavoury and overpriced, some even appeared to be selling the previous day’s leftovers at full price.
Thirdly, and the most disappointing, was how the crafts were displayed.
A beautiful hand crocheted rug/shawl was displayed scrunched up and hanging on nails.
All of the patchwork and crafted quilts were also displayed - in my opinion - not necessarily the most attractively, hanging off hooks and bunched up. None of the quilts was easily observed.
I would much rather have seen the patterns on the quilts, not just the borders of them.Will I go again next year, I don’t think so.
